Output 61578d91c1f2f3a8d2d37ef84504f709e1c40cea2d554bf111b857fca342bccf:9

value
26136720
script pubkey
OP_0 OP_PUSHBYTES_20 ac3e3aa8b33c2a70d682719bd0bfc391f6a893be
address
bc1q4slr429n8s48p45zwxdap07rj8m23ya72f44ut
transaction
61578d91c1f2f3a8d2d37ef84504f709e1c40cea2d554bf111b857fca342bccf
spent
false